About the Role:
Hims is looking for a bright, detail-oriented, and passionate Compounding Training Coordinator to join our Fulfillment Operations Team based in Gilbert, AZ. The Compounding Training Coordinator plays a critical role in ensuring the effective scheduling, coordination, and execution of training for all process paths in the Compounding Lab. This role supports the Learning Manager and collaborates closely with Operations, HR, Continuous Improvement, Safety, and Recruiting teams to maintain compliance and drive a strong learning culture.

Facilitate training for new hires, cross-training, and ongoing development across assigned operational areas.
Conduct remediation and retraining sessions as needed to address performance gaps or compliance issues.
Develop and maintain the training schedule for new hires, cross-training, and annual training programs in coordination with site leadership.
Maintain accurate training records, track completion rates, and ensure documentation aligns with Good Documentation Practices (GDP) and regulatory requirements.
Support audit readiness by maintaining up-to-date, accessible training records for regulatory and internal reviews.
Utilize LMS platforms to assign, track, and report on training completion and effectiveness.
Collaborate with Operations, Quality, Compliance, Safety, and HR to identify skill gaps and ensure training programs meet business and compliance needs.
Audit tenured associates to ensure competencies are being met continuously.
Maintain floor presence to retain process knowledge, identify training gaps, and support operational teams.
Work with subject matter experts to ensure accuracy and relevance of training content.
Create and update training materials ensuring content is current and compliant.
Maintain daily communication with Operations, HR, Recruiting, and other teams to stay aligned on training priorities.
Engage associates to build and maintain a strong safety culture.
Support operational workflows by contributing to path and process tasks when training responsibilities are fulfilled.
Ensure all training programs comply with USP, FDA, and state board of pharmacy requirements.
